
Life Capsule for Today 11th July, 2024
Theme: Divine Health (5)
Topic: Sickness Is Not God’s will
Memory Verse for the week: 3Jn 1:2 Beloved, I wish above all things that thou mayest prosper and be in health, even as thy soul prospereth.
Today’s Reading:Joh 6:38
38 For I came down from heaven, not to do mine own will, but the will of him that sent me.
Act 10:38
38 How God anointed Jesus of Nazareth with the Holy Ghost and with power: who went about doing good, and healing all that were oppressed of the devil; for God was with him.
Words of the Ministry
We have been considering the matter of divine health, a lot has been said concerning God’s provision for our healing and the power of the indwelling Holy Spirit. One of the several complaints I hear from many believers is that, if this were true, why are they still falling sick and remain sick? It gets so bad that some even put the blame on God saying its God’s will. They believe God may just want them to be sick to know how the sick feels or God is using their sickness to humble them or maybe it’s not God’s time. To both points, I would like to say that is just a figment of their imagination as the bible never portrays God as such a wicked father (Mat 7.11).
Concerning the reasons for sickness, although all sicknesses are traceable to the devil and the fall of man but not all sickness are directly caused by the devil as people fall sick due to their sinful lifestyle, what they eat, drink, how much they rest and sleep etc. it is therefore not true that God uses sicknesses to teach us a lesson or to make us know how other feel when sick. In the book of James, the apostle said if any is sick, they should call on the elders and if the sick has committed a sin, it would be forgiven him (Jam 5.14-16), by implication, sin is a possible reason for bodily sickness.
As we consider today’s reading, we see the Lord in Jhn 6.38 stating he came to do the father’s will, in other words, all we see Jesus do was the will of the father. As we look at the Life of Jesus as recorded in Acts 10,.38, the bible said he went about doing good because the will of God for mankind is good, defining the good, the author said, he went about healing the sick and casting out devils because God was with him. God being with him was also a confirmation of him doing the will of God and that further confirms that sickness isn’t God’s will for mankind.
Dear saints, do not be deceived by false teachers or drawn into self-condemnation by the devil. The devil comes sowing seeds that you are not good enough, your sins and past has eventually caught up with you, God is testing your patience or God is using you as an example to help others tomorrow, all the aforementioned is a lie from hell, Jam5.14-16 says even a sinful sick should be prayed for and not only would he be healed, his sins would also be forgiven, that suggests that your sins would not stop your healing but may bring it back (Jhn 5.14). There is therefore no condemnation to those who are in Christ Jesus and if God gave us his only begotten son, how much more would he give us bodily healing, may the Lord grant us light.
